Which of the following is false about the structure of enzymes?




Every enzyme has an active site.



An enzyme can catalyze most reactions if the reactants are at a high concentration.



An enzyme’s active site is determined by the shape of the enzyme.



Enzymes speed up reaction rates.


Sagot :

Answer:

Number 2 is false

Explanation:

an enzyme cannot do that.
